The Olympics

The Olympics is an international sporting event that takes place every four years. athletes from all over the world come together to compete in a variety of different sports. The Olympics is a great way to see some of the best athletes in the world compete against each other.

The NBA Finals

The NBA Finals are the championship series of the National Basketball Association (NBA). The Eastern and Western conference champions play a best-of-seven game series to determine the league champion. The winning team of the series receives the Larry O’Brien Championship Trophy.

The World Series

The World Series is the annual championship series of Major League Baseball (MLB) in North America, contested since 1903 between the American League (AL) champion team and the National League (NL) champion team. The winner of the World Series championship is determined through a best-of-seven playoff, and the winning team is awarded the Commissioner’s Trophy. As the series is played during October, it is sometimes referred to as the Fall Classic.

The Kentucky Derby

The Kentucky Derby is a horse race that is held annually in Louisville, Kentucky, United States. The Derby is the first leg of the American Triple Crown and is followed by the Preakness Stakes and the Belmont Stakes. The field of horses varies each year but typically includes around 20 runners.

The race is run on a dirt track oval that measures one and a quarter miles (2 km). The Derby is known as “The Run for the Roses” because a blanket of roses is draped over the winner. It is also sometimes referred to as “The Most Exciting Two Minutes In Sports” or “The Greatest Two Minutes In Sports” because of its relatively short duration.
